Diversify your storage options. Consider allocating funds across several secure avenues: high-yield savings accounts for accessibility and growth, certificates of deposit (CDs) for better interest rates with lower risk, real estate for long-term appreciation, and government or municipal bonds for a stable income. Consult a financial advisor for personalized recommendations to optimize safety and returns.

- What are the safest ways to store a million dollars? The safest ways include spreading the funds across high-yield savings accounts, certificates of deposit (CDs), real estate, and government or municipal bonds to balance security and returns.
- Should I consult a financial advisor before investing a large sum? Yes, consulting a financial advisor helps you tailor your investment strategy to optimize safety, returns, and your personal financial goals.
- How does diversifying my investments protect my million dollars? Diversification reduces risk by allocating funds across different asset classes, so that poor performance in one area is offset by gains in another.
